In 1999, American non-commercial PBS (Public Broadcasting Service) aired a 4-part Smithsonian Institution series "for public television and radio that explores the richness and vitality of American music at the close of the twentieth century". The series was "The Mississippi River Of Song".
This is episode #3 called "Southern Fusion". Featured in this clip are Levon Helm, James Cotton, delta-blues man "Big" Jack Johnson, The Jelly Roll Kings, and contemporary Delta bluesman Johnny Billington.
